Backing Up User Data on the Garmin Astro, Alpha and Fenix 3
To backup your User Data:
- Download and install the free BaseCamp program from the Garmin website
- Connect your Alpha or Astro handheld or Fenix 3 watch to your computer using the provided USB cable
- Power on your device, if needed
- Open up BaseCamp
- Wait for your device to be listed on the left side of the program
- Right-click on the folder (usually called Internal Storage) below your GPS Device
- Select Copy
- Right-click on My Collection
- Select Paste
- Wait for the data to finish transferring
- Right-click on the folder below device
- Select Eject
This will backup the user data from the GPS device with a USB interface and save it in the My Collection folder. BaseCamp will automatically save all information in the My Collection folder.
To restore your User Data to your device:
- Repeat steps 1-4 above
- Right-click on My Collection
- Select Copy
- Right-click on the folder (usually called Internal Storage) below your GPS Device
- Select Paste
- Repeat Steps 9-11 above
The data will now be transferred to the device.
